The reference to Crispin Bay was from a poem by Donald Hall, "Wolf = Knife"-- "In the mid August, in the second year of my First Polar Expedition, the snow and ice of winter almost upon us, Kantiuk and I attempted to dash the sledge along Crispin Bay, searching again for relics of the Frankline Expedition. " I'm guessing it's literary only, not a real location. But please let me = know if you know otherwise. Thanks again.
